Marcus Mariota Catches Trick Play Touchdown

Marcus grab the wheel

Marcus Mariota has thrown for 19 touchdowns in his rookie season, but today he was on the opposite end of that formula against the New York Jets.

With the game already in the bag for New York, Mike Mularkey had to resort to a trick play to get the Tennessee Titans on the scoreboard and it paid off. Mariota went in motion and lined up on the outside against Calvin Pryor and his speed surprised the defensive back so much that he stumbled and Marcus left him in the dust. It was more than an easy catch for the Titans QB, who just had to catch it and walk it in. Pryor was really shook, though. Just look at how he fell.

Mariota ended the game with throwing 21/39 for 274 yards, but had no touchdowns (besides this one) and one interception on the loss.

FINAL: NYJ 30 | TEN 8
